In the region of Seridó Paraibano industries are located where kaolin is the main raw material. This term is used both for the rock and for the product resulting from processing, it usually contains impurities, which makes the process and consequently its use difficult. In the processing of kaolin in the region, tailings are generated that are objects of characterization study with the purpose of proper disposal. The present work aims at the structural chemical characterization of kaolin waste generated by mining companies in the region of the Pegmatitic Province of Seridó. Tailings samples were collected from two different companies that benefit kaolin in the municipality of Junco do Seridó. After an intense literature review, followed by chemical analysis by FRX, structural characterization using the SEM/EDS, Thermal Analysis TG/DSC, a detailing of the composition of the material was made. Chemical analyzes show that the samples have a basic composition of silicon and aluminum. In the thermogravimetric analysis, it indicates that the analyzed samples have a water content compatible with the theoretical and the MEV/EDS observations demonstrate that there is no increase in the content of potentially radioactive material, which makes the residue of great potential to be used.
